Not a completely original idea.  I've seen a few people mention these tricks, but i'm combining everything and fleshing it out.

Basic ideas are
Revenant, for toughness (you got a large buffer from death).
Impaling Spear + Winter/Frost for accuracy (90%)
Eldrich Strike + Battering Shield + Polearm Momentum for stickiness (interupt movement with positioning and prone).
White Lotus Master Riposte for damage (bad idea to attack you either).

Variants Show

Race: This works as a regular half-elf as well. While you loose a fair bit of toughness that way, you save some feats.  Better if you have good leader support.

Stats:  You want to start with 18 Con, and need 15 Wis/Dex by paragon.  This gives you some room to play.  Always boost Con (of course), and the others can be...
Dex: More Init and reflex
Wis: More Will and Slashing Storm damage
Int/Cha: 13 by paragon will allow you to take a better MC arcane feat (anything is better then Adept Dilitantte).  MC artificer for a heal is a good option, as is Pact Initiate for a 1/enounter ranged attack.

Items:  A few items would certainly help (full item load out here)
Frost Weapon could replace Arcane Admxiture, shift some feats down.
Rushing Cleats/controling weapon can replace Battering Shield, which means you can go 2-handed (greatspear), or just save a feat.
Bonus to saving throws would help keep you safe, and possibly replace (or stack) Resilent Focus.
Iron Armbands of Power/dragon shard, would add alot of damage (like 10 each).

Feats can be re-ordered or replaced somewhat:
Reserve Maneuver for Come and Get it will help keep get enemies close in the first place (even though you'll miss).
White Lotus feats can be taken before frost feats, this will increase you damage earlier, but may encourage enemies to run.
Disciple of Death can replace Resilient Focus, depending on how things go.
Hindering Shield will help keep people close.
Greatspear is a nice option, allowing you hit on a 2 and giving you a damage boost.  You'd need a slide booster though.

General Play:  Super Knight plays like most other knights, so tactics are very straight forward.  Rush in and get yourself surrounded.  Super Knight is just tougher, and more difficult to get away from.

Heroic: Show

Revenant, Fighter
Eldritch Strike: Eldritch Strike Constitution
Choose your Race in Life: Half-Elf

STARTING ABILITY SCORES
Str 10, Con 18, Dex 13, Int 8, Wis 13, Cha 10.
Increase Con every time, one point into Dex to round it off, and the rest into Wis

FEATS
Level 1: Melee Training (Constitution) Needed in heroic to hit things
Level 2: Spear Expertise Accuracy feat tax, though we may charge on occasion
Level 4: Toughness This is really an open slot for now
Level 6: Improved Defense feat tax
Level 8: Half-Elf Soul
Eldritch Strike will soon to be the main attack
Level 10: Battering Shield Slide booster for eldritch strike

Super Knight, with 20 AC and 20 Con and the ability to go below 0 for a turn, starts very tough and can very easily tank.  It's not very sticky yet, but even a weakened MBA is still a threat, and should get the job done.  You can use a longsword for boosted accuracy, but make sure you have a nice spear when you hit 11.

Paragon: Show

Paragon Path: Kensei Mostly for the accuracy boost, but there are other good PP's (like Iron Vanguard) out there as well.

Level 11: Melee Training -> Versatile Master Our new MBA, we now slide, as well as doing full Con damage
Level 11: Polearm Momentum Combined with Battering Shield, Eldritch Strike now knocks prone
Level 12: Fierce Vitality Gives us alot more room to take damage
Level 14: Impaling Spear Attacking reflex is about a +2 to hit
Level 16:
Toughness -> Adept Dilettante A prereq.
Level 16: Arcane Admixture Eldritch strike now does cold damage
Level 18: Lasting Frost Eldrtich strike now applies vulnerability, adding some damage.
Level 20: Wintertouched Eldritch strike now gives us CA, making us more accurate
As soon as we hit 11, we become much more sticky, as we slide enemies around ouselves and keep people down.  We also become a fair bit harder to kill, being able to stay up longer.  We then continue to boost our accuracy till we hit on a 3 to make it even harder to escape.

Epic: Show

Epic Destiny: Unyielding Sentinel Con boosts accuracy, Unbreakable helps status effects (and death saves), are the big draws, but the other features are hardly wasted.

Level 21: Ghostly Vitality Big boost to survivability
Level 22: White Lotus Riposte A solid damage boost
Level 24: White Lotus Master Riposte A huge damage boost
Level 26: Slashing Storm Small AOE damage
Level 28: Resilent Focus Shake off effects easier, also boost death saves
Level 30: Quickened Spellcasting Everyone can use a minor action attack


Ghostly Vitality boost surviveability.  Resilent Focus + Unbreakable + Spirit of War prevent most status effects (87.75% at the start of your turn).  All that's left is damage, which we can make into something respectable.

 75.34 DPR Show

Assuming CA (winterfrost/prone)
Assuming Vuln (winterfrost)
Assuming Poised Assault stance (To hit is importaint).
Assuming 2 attacks (WLMR, or Defender's Aura).
NOT assuming WLR (slightly too conditional, though 10+5 vuln * .9  = 15 more damage).

Attack: 10 Con + 15 lvl + 2 prof + 6 enh + 1 talent + 3 feat + 1 kensei + 1 stance + 2 CA = 41.
41 vs 44 (ref) = 85% hit, 5% crit
Damage: 2d8 (9) Weapon + 10 Con + 6 enh + 3 Weapon Mastery + 4 Kensei + 5 Vuln = 37
Crit:  16 + 10 + 6 + 3 + 4 + 5 + 6d6 (21) = 65
Per hit: 37 * .85 + 65 * .05 = 34.7
Slashing storm: 1 - .1 * .1 * 6 = 5.94
Total: 33.7 * 2 attacks + 5.94 = 75.34

I'm using 3 feats, Fierce Vitality, Ghostly Vitality, and Dicple of Death (+ Improved Defense).  I don't consider it excessive for a defender.  Though i could certainly be convinced to replace Diciple of Death with the +2 to all saves, especially since knights get a start-of-turn save.

Also, if you're proning people like mad is Wintertouched really necessary?


Most enemies will stand up before they do anything, so you won't get the CA from Prone (winter also adds damage).   Prone is more to stop movement then it is to grant CA.  Unless i'm missing a way to get immobilize, which would be better.
